| Summary: | Artist Kip Fulbeck continues his project, begun in 2001, of photographing persons who identify as "Hapa"--of mixed Asian/Pacific Islander descent--as a means of promoting awareness and positive acceptance of multiracial identity. As a follow-up to "kip fulbeck: part asian, 100% hapa", his groundbreaking 2006 exhibition, hapa.me pairs the photographs and statements from that exhibition with contemporary portraits of the same individuals and newly written statements, showing not only their physical changes in the ensuing years, but also changes in their perspectives and outlooks on the world. |
